Vue中使用路由的几个主要原因·单页面应用·简化导航路由简化了应用中的导航

Vue中使用路由的几个主要原因

在Vue中使用路由有几个非常实用的原因,包括实现单页面应用(SPA)、简化导航、状态管理与组件复用,以及SEO优化和用户体验提升。这些原因让路由成为了现代Web应用开发的重要工具。

一、实现单页面应用(SPA)

单页面应用(SPA)意味着所有交互都在一个页面上完成,无需重新加载。Vue Router允许我们在不刷新页面的情况下切换视图,从而提升响应速度和用户体验。

二、简化导航

路由简化了应用中的导航。开发者可以定义路由规则,每个路由对应一个组件或视图,方便地在视图间切换。

三、状态管理与组件复用

在大型应用中,状态管理和组件复用至关重要。路由可以帮助我们集中管理状态,同时提高组件的复用性。

四、SEO优化与用户体验提升

虽然SPA有SEO优化的挑战,但通过合理配置路由和服务器端渲染,可以有效提升SEO表现和用户体验。

五、详细解释与实例说明

下面是一个简单的Vue Router配置示例,展示了如何定义路由和视图切换:

const routes = [
  { path: '/', component: Home },
  { path: '/about', component: About }
];

结论与建议

使用路由在Vue中具有多方面优势,包括实现SPA、简化导航、状态管理与组件复用、SEO优化和用户体验提升。以下是一些建议:

相关问答FAQs

问题 答案
为什么在Vue中需要使用路由? 为了实现单页应用(SPA)的路由功能,提高用户体验和性能。
路由在Vue中的作用是什么? 实现页面之间的跳转和导航,提供更流畅的用户体验。
使用路由的好处有哪些? 提升用户体验、代码组织、SEO优化和用户权限控制。